        Finaly I succeeded with Strategy Builder ..., but now I notice that after a number of trades my Moving Average Expert/ ATM stops accepting orders for the day and subsequent signal/ orders are rejected ..., which section of Builder Process do I have to revisit? thanks.

        Comment


          #34
          Hello Ziklag,

          Thank you for your note.

          The first thing I would recommend would be to turn on the Order Trace function:

          Strategy Builder > Default Properties > More Properties > Trace Orders, or:

          Once you then recompile the strategy, you can open a new NinjaScript Output window under New > NinjaScript Output. This will print a log of any orders submitted by the strategy during while it's running, along with any ignored orders. You can then look through and see what may be occurring.

          Here is a link to our help guide that goes into more detail on tracing orders:

          https://ninjatrader.com/support/help...aceorders2.htm

          Trace orders alone may not give you the full picture of whether or not a trade should have been entered on a given bar, so adding prints to your strategy that will show in the NinjaScript Output window, with information on what the variables you're using for your conditions are on a particular bar, can be helpful.

          This forum post goes into great detail on how to use prints to help figure out where issues may stem from — this should get you going in the correct direction. You can add these using the Strategy Builder.

          https://ninjatrader.com/support/foru...ns-not-working

          If you run into issues like we saw here, the above information will allow you to print out all values used in the condition in question that may be evaluating differently and keeping your orders from being submitted. With the printout information you can assess what is different between the two.
